Explore Ahmedabad: A Cultural Gem in Gujarat, India

Ahmedabad, located in the western Indian state of Gujarat, is a city where history and modernity intertwine, boasting a rich cultural heritage. The climate here is hot, with the average temperature between 20°C and 30°C from November to February, making it the best time to travel. During the hot summer months (March to June), the average temperature can reach 35°C to 40°C or even higher, so be prepared for the heat. Follow this guide to explore this charming city! Historical and Cultural Attractions 1. Jama Masjid: One of Ahmedabad's most famous mosques, built in 1423, featuring exquisite arches and marble carvings. Enter the mosque to experience the serene and solemn atmosphere and admire its unique architectural style. The interior of the mosque is spacious and beautifully decorated, with sunlight streaming through the stained-glass windows, creating a beautiful play of light and shadow that is truly breathtaking. 2. Sardar Patel Museum: The museum houses a rich collection of art, archaeological artifacts, and historical materials, allowing you to delve into the history and culture of Gujarat. From ancient sculptures to exquisite paintings, each exhibit tells a story of the past, taking you on a journey through time to appreciate the city's development and transformation. 3. Ahmedabad Old City: Stroll through the narrow streets lined with colorful traditional buildings, as if stepping back in time. Here, you'll find many ancient temples, mansions, and bustling markets, filled with a vibrant atmosphere. You can buy handicrafts at the market, sample local snacks, and experience the daily life of the locals. Natural Scenery 1. Kankaria Lake: This is the largest lake in Ahmedabad, surrounded by amusement parks, a zoo, and a water park. Here, you can rent a boat and enjoy the picturesque scenery, or take a leisurely walk along the lakeside path. In the evening, the lights around the lake create an even more enchanting scene. 2. Sabarmati Riverfront: The renovated riverfront area has become a popular spot for recreation and leisure for both residents and tourists. Take a stroll along the riverbank, admire the river views, and discover art installations and cultural events. This is also a great place to watch the sunset. As the sun sets, the sky turns orange-red, reflecting beautifully on the river, creating a breathtaking view. Food Experience 1. Gujarati Cuisine: Ahmedabad's cuisine is mainly Gujarati, with diverse flavors known for its balance of sweet, sour, and spicy. Be sure to try Dosa, a thin pancake served with various sauces and side dishes, offering a rich and flavorful experience. Also, try Lassi, a yogurt drink available in sweet and salty versions, perfect for cooling off in the heat. 2. Street Food: Ahmedabad's streets are lined with delicious street food stalls. Try Vada Pav, a bun filled with a spicy potato patty, or Chapati, a whole-wheat flatbread served with various curries, a staple food for locals. Travel Tips 1. Dress Code: India is a country with a strong religious atmosphere. When visiting religious sites, dress respectfully and avoid revealing clothing. You'll typically need to remove your shoes before entering temples and mosques. 2. Food Hygiene: Due to varying hygiene standards in India, it's advisable to choose reputable restaurants and avoid raw or cold food from street vendors to prevent food poisoning. Drink plenty of water, preferably bottled water. 3. Transportation: Ahmedabad's traffic can be congested. Consider using public transport such as buses, taxis, or auto-rickshaws. When taking an auto-rickshaw, always negotiate the fare beforehand to avoid being overcharged. 4. Safety: While Ahmedabad is a relatively safe city, be mindful of your belongings in crowded areas. Avoid carrying excessive cash or valuables. Women traveling at night are advised to do so in groups.
